    1. Izotope ozone maximiser section I love how transparent and predictable the limiter is It defeated all other limters hands down

    2. 6144 eq, Great Eq I don't know why I like it so much but I end up using it again over and over, it does not have any surgical option and has a really distinct sound

    3. tranqulizer, with maximum oversampling, every band can be used stereo or mid side and has its own phase button so you can make it sound like any other surgical eq by my opinion

    4. Lexicon reverb: could be ValhallaRoom or breverb or whatever you like ( I didn't like breverb myself)
    as long as it works for you, I think I like the lexicon cause it smears the sound how I like it

    5. Alloy2: this could be fabfilter pro ds to , but hate to use a desser I rather try to prevent it,

    1 spuper special secret trick of mine is done in alloy 1 actually, I use the eq section to boost the highs on a rap vocal. than boost a little transient and then top it off with the desser functioning like a multi-band, only compressing the top end, it has a sound to it i can't reproduce in alloy 2 or any other rack, (Believe me I tried ;) )

    Plugin Alliance Maag EQ - To give a nice boost (that you most likely feel more than hear) to the higher high-end by increasing it with the 'Air' function.
    The Glue
    IK Multimedia EQP1 - Personally, the best sounding EQP1 VST. I use it to give a very slight low-q boost to the low and high-mids.
    Plugin Alliance DSM - One of the few digital limiters that don't turn your waveform into squares. Sounds great.
    iZotope Ozone 5 - For the imager which I add to high frequencies while keeping the lows as mono as possible and also for the dither. MBIT+/Normal to bring it to 16-bit is still a pro favourite.
